Halo/B pillar rubber strip replacement HELP
I went to was my 2005 C6 and noticed that the rubber strip between the rear glass and the halo was starting to come off. I tried searching for videos/ threads on how to fix this, but couldn’t find any.

I had the same issue a few years ago. Easy enough to purchase the new seal, but getting it installed with the hatch open is next to impossible because the hinges and hatch itself get in the way to correctly align and stick the new seal on.
The best way is one of two things.
1) Remove the hatch window assembly to get at the halo seal to properly remove the residue of the old seal, and clean the area with alcohol to assure a good adhesion of the seal tape.
2) Easiest - Remove the halo to clean and remove residue, and install new seal.
There are many video's showing how to do the removal of both items. Pick the one that looks easiest to you.
Good Luck

My apologies that my car is at my upholsterer's so I cannot get a pic for you but he did an install of this gasket for me. I believe the gasket was <$50. He removed the hatch (I installed chrome hinges at the top ), removed the old gasket, cleaned the adhesive from the old, and the new gasket was peal and stick. Looks good.
